Abstract
A thermoset resin for forming parts to be metal plated includes a vat photopolymerization (VPP) thermoset resin and an etchable phase disposed in the VPP thermoset resin. The etchable phase is etched from a surface of a part formed from the VPP thermoset resin such that a plurality of micro-mechanical locking sites is formed on the surface of the part. The etchable phase is at least one of organic particles, organic resins, inorganic particles, and copolymers of the VPP thermoset resin. For example, the etchable phase can be a polybutadiene phase and/or a mineral such as calcium carbonate.
